If you’re planning to depart from Delhi Airport T3, please be aware that the most popular lounge at Terminal 3 has been temporarily closed without prior notice.

As per a report published by Live from a Lounge, the Plaza Premium Lounge has the most widespread access, including for Credit Cards and Vistara customers, but was close unexpectedly on November 12, 2022.

The move also forced Vistara, to suspend its lounge service at Terminal 3 of Delhi Airport. Commenting on the same, the airline in a social media post said,

“In adherence to the recent mandate from the authorities, Plaza Premium lounge services at Delhi Terminal 3 have been suspended. Lounge services will be unavailable at Indira Gandhi International Airport, Terminal 3. Any inconvenience caused is deeply regretted.”

Vistara has made alternative arrangements for eligible passengers flying in Business Class or Vistara Gold/Platinum customers while the lounge is closed. The airline is sending eligible travellers to the Dilli Streat eatery on the ground floor of Delhi T3 Domestic.

There is no information available regarding the planned reopening of the Plaza Premium Lounge. However, it is speculated that the Plaza Premium Lounge is temporarily shut down so that work can be finished on the Encalm lounge next door, which is scheduled to open this month.
